Summary
The post-holder will support the safe and timely management of incoming clinical correspondence. They will work within their training, competence, practice protocols and information-governance requirements at all times. Document processing and coding Open and process correspondence received through SystmOne Document Management and the agreed team workflow Read the complete document before deciding what information or action it contains Use the practice Document Processing template and enter the correct clinic, admission, discharge and scanned dates Code relevant diagnoses, conditions, procedures, results, observations and lifestyle information accurately Apply the correct problem status, severity and patient-summary settings in line with the practice coding guide Check for existing coded problems to avoid unnecessary duplication and link information appropriately Make problems inactive when the correspondence confirms that this is appropriate and permitted by local guidance Follow specific practice routes for documents that must be sent to a named clinician or team Actions and escalation Identify and clearly mark medication changes, GP actions, appointment requests and referral requests Forward each action to the correct person with a clear explanation of what is required Send a document to more than one recipient when separate actions are required Check again for outstanding actions before filing any document Do not code or file information when its meaning, date, diagnosis or required action is unclear Escalate urgent, unexpected or clinically significant information promptly using the agreed process Report errors, near misses and recurring document-quality problems to the appropriate manager Records confidentiality and teamwork Maintain accurate, clear and timely electronic patient records Protect patient and practice information and follow confidentiality, data-protection and information-governance requirements Work closely with GPs, clinicians and administrative colleagues to resolve queries Manage the allocated workload in priority order and communicate promptly if work is delayed Attend induction, mandatory training, appraisal and relevant team meetings Undertake other reasonable administrative duties appropriate to the role
